Transaction 40ad3cf5593c22b372d2fa31c17352f7a3184bbcc54ff81985813efdfc7f3079
1 Input
1 Output
-
40ad3cf5593c22b372d2fa31c17352f7a3184bbcc54ff81985813efdfc7f3079:0
- value
- 1182582
- script pubkey
- OP_0 OP_PUSHBYTES_20 31cb7f268949bdd7895f56a1e8568aebc20e94bf
- address
- bc1qx89h7f5ffx7a0z2l26s7s452a0pqa99lxwwctk